At times, life can present challenges. Sometimes, it becomes too much to juggle work, family, finances and other commitments. That's when you can turn to the EAP. Our professionally trained counselors are available and believe that almost every problem can be successfully resolved once that problem is recognized, assistance is provided and action taken.
Our counselors are experienced, licensed mental health professionals who can help with personal, family and workplace problems. Examples are:
Work-related stress Substance Abuse
Relationship or Marital Issues Parent/Child Conflict
Depression Unresolved Grief
Anxiety Domestic Violence
Procrastination
Additionally, counselors can assist with referrals to physicians and to legal and financial resources. In some cases, these costs are based on the individual's ability to pay. Health insurance, depending on the employee's insurance plan, may cover some of these fees.

Is the EAP Confidential?
Yes, it is confidential. Your EAP clinician, as a licensed professional, is bound by legal and ethical guidelines on confidentiality. The limits on confidentiality are imposed by law.
Should you have any specific questions concerning these issues, ask your counselor. The respect of your confidentiality is the cornerstone of the EAP's success.
Who is Eligible for EAP Services?
Employees and immediate family or household members, or those with whom you live that make up a family. Should you have questions, please ask when scheduling your initial appointment.
